At the core of this model is the Milwaukee-Eight® 121 High Output engine. It’s the most powerful production engine Harley-Davidson® has ever released, putting out 127 horsepower and 145 ft-lb of torque. But this isn’t a bike that feels wild or untamed. The throttle response is smooth and controlled. There’s a satisfying rush when you twist the grip, but the power delivery doesn’t overwhelm. It supports your ride, rather than stealing the show.

Suspension might not be the first thing on a rider’s mind when choosing a touring model, but it quickly becomes a favorite feature once you’ve ridden the 2025 Harley-Davidson® CVO™ Road Glide® ST.

The SHOWA® 47mm inverted front forks up front and dual outboard remote reservoir shocks in the rear work together to soak up rough patches and give you a planted feel through corners. The system is fully adjustable, letting riders fine-tune it to match their weight, riding style, or even a particularly demanding stretch of Georgia pavement.

And because the rear shocks sit between the saddlebags and the rear fender, the weight distribution feels tighter and more centered. That’s the kind of subtle detail that doesn’t always get the spotlight, but it makes every mile feel more stable and more enjoyable.

Let’s talk about the digital side of this machine. The 12.3-inch touchscreen is large, yes, but it doesn’t overwhelm. Instead, it blends into the dash naturally and becomes part of the flow. It gives you everything you need: navigation with real-time traffic, music control, and access to a fully integrated ride mode system.

You get eight ride modes, including Track and Track+, which are dialed in for aggressive, closed-course situations. Most local riders near Covington probably won’t toggle into those often, but knowing the bike has that capability speaks to how much thought went into its tuning.

Then there’s the safety technology. We’re talking about a full set of cornering enhancements for braking, traction, and slip control. It’s not about replacing the rider’s instincts; it’s about adding a second layer of confidence when the road turns unpredictable. Let’s not pretend the rumble doesn’t matter. It does. And on the 2025 Harley-Davidson® CVO™ Road Glide® ST, it’s part of the package. The titanium mufflers not only cut weight but also produce a deep, refined rumble that never feels cheap or hollow. It’s a low, pulsing frequency at idle and a rich rumble when opened up, a resonance that belongs on this kind of machine.

The Rockford Fosgate® Stage II audio system also deserves a nod. It pushes out a clean, punchy melody even at speed, making those long rides feel more like a rolling concert. Especially when you’re blasting classic rock or cruising with a podcast, the audio holds up.
